  Langer’s journey into the world of songwriting began when he decided to form a band with a couple of his schoolmates. He dove into a furious exploration of the guitar, immersing himself in the iconic sounds of 90s rock and grunge. Soon enough, his musical tastes grew to encompass jazz and experimental rock. It was a journey that led him to appreciate the conceptual ideas behind the music as much as their sonic manifestations.  As he continues down the winding path of a musician infatuated with his craft, the culmination of his musical journey is marked by this labor of love and determination, borne out of sheer will and appreciation for the arts. Langer’s fusion of genres, blending classic rock, punk, and even elements of jazz, bears witness to an artist unafraid to explore and transcend boundaries. Natalie Estes in love with the arts




Natalie Estes was born and raised in Nashville, Tennessee. Falling in love with the arts at an early age, she grew up dancing (ballet, modern, jazz) at Nashville Ballet. She first began to sing in High School when she learned Adele’s “To Make You Feel My Love” and quickly fell head over heels in love with music. Immediately she begin writing her own music and hasn’t looked back since. Natalie has co-written with writers including Jon Ingoldsby, Pam Sheyne and David Smart just to name a few. 
In 2015 Natalie started recording songs for her upcoming EP titled 20/20 Vision with producer David Huff in Los Angeles at the House of Blues. Among the musicians on the record were Victor Indrizzo and Tim Pierce. She is currently a student at Vanderbilt University in Nashville while continuing to pursue her career in music.
